我开发了一款使用google maps api v2的小型Android应用。
在我的设备上(Galaxy S1 I9000)一切正常,所以我发送了一个APK给我的朋友,所以他可以测试它并使用adb install app.apk
安装它,但当他打开应用程序时,没有地图是显示(他能够看到主屏幕,但是当点击一个按钮使他进入地图屏幕时他会看到黑色)。
我缺少什么?
答案 0 :(得分:2)
终于明白了:)
当我通过eclipse导出APK时,我创建了一个新证书,但是当我使用谷歌地图服务签名时,我提供了ADT附带的调试证书。
因此谷歌无法识别证书并阻止了该服务。